Transaction dbc119a142c5bf9908b03278f328182c33c63324760975458a191a1a3b898851
1 Input
1 Output
-
dbc119a142c5bf9908b03278f328182c33c63324760975458a191a1a3b898851:0
- value
- 89087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8cdb898b96e8cd31452345adb3c7805dcbbb6e5 OP_EQUAL
- address
- 3MTNKjKEok5jirUvykMNa4LirQv7MiTc3C